Buying my first Unit
The Striker units have GPS but no mapping. It's basically a blank white screen you can save waypoints on. Think about this....you have a 17-18' boat and have a transom transducer you could hit a shallow rock or sand bar without it even showing up. As a general rule and you may know this, you should never use a unit or a map card as your sole means of navigation. Too many variables. Hope this helps.

Motor mounting ?
I'm no expert at all, but I've talked with Wayne P about SI on a trolling motor. He said he uses it and it works just fine. He also said that there is some distortion when you move your TM but quickly clears up. If you're constantly moving your TM around say on windy days or have it in "anchor mode" or "spot lock" and it's always moving you're going to be disappointed. If you're drifting, or cruising along on the same course with an occasional adjustment of the TM it's going to work just fine. Again I'm not expert, this is in a nutshell the conversation Wayne P and I had.
